We are enjoying watching the BBC series The Indian Doctor (2011-2013). Set in a small Welsh coal-mining town in the 1960s, the doctor and his wife--newly emigrated--have to figure out how to fit into the close-knit Welsh community. Heartwarming but with an edge, we were especially intrigued by Season 2 which deals with a smallpox outbreak; it resonates strongly with what we are experiencing today in coping with the coronavirus. There are three seasons that are now streaming on the BBC iPlayer and Acorn TV in the US. The Indian Doctor is played by Sanjeev Bhaskar, remembered fondly as Nicola Walker's partner in Unforgotten.
